About us
Paths for Families is an adoption and family well-being organization that builds and sustains families and advocates for best practices in the community. For 33 years, we’ve woven human-centered care, evidence-based practices, and trauma-informed expertise into the lives of more than 15,000 children and families across DC, Maryland, and Virginia. We’re here for expectant parents exploring adoption, birth parents, adoptive families, children in need of adoption, people who were adopted, and professionals in the community. Understanding every path is unique, we offer placement services, counseling, and training, to nurture positive and restorative experiences. On a systemic level, we share our training with professionals in child welfare and the broader community to build more trauma-responsive systems of care. We treat everyone with the understanding, kindness, and respect that we believe all humans deserve. This is the compass that guides us in our work, putting human dignity and ethical practices at the forefront of everything we do for children, families, and their communities so they can genuinely feel that they are not alone on this journey. Our vision is that every child will grow and thrive within a caring, supportive family and community: Every Child, Every Family, Every Step of the Way.

September is #KinshipCareMonth and we're shining a spotlight on the remarkable influence of kinship care on families and their communities! Kinship care not only nurtures strong familial bonds, but also safeguards cultural heritage, preserves vital family connections, and plays a crucial role in reducing the trauma of separation. By recognizing the value of these connections and supporting a kin-first culture, we can work towards a child and family well-being system that truly supports the needs of children, families, and communities.
